Abstract
Link residual closeness (LRC) is a new sensitive characteristic for network vulnerability analysis. LRC measures the vulnerability even when the removal of links does not disconnect the network. In this paper, the robustness of wheel type network topologies is modeled and analyzed via LRC in the face of possible link destruction.
